To cite a primary source from a secondary source in Chicago style, include the original source in your bibliography and in-text citation, followed by "quoted in" and the secondary source information.
Primary sources are original materials or first-hand accounts, while secondary sources analyze or interpret primary sources. In a Chicago style bibliography, primary sources are cited directly, while secondary sources are cited to support or provide context for the primary sources.
The objective of primary tillage is to attain a reasonable depth of soft soil, incorporate crop residues, kill weeds, and to aerate the soil. Secondary tillage is any subsequent tillage, to incorporate fertilizers, reduce the soil to a finer tilth, level the surface, or control weeds.
A research paper can effectively incorporate both primary and secondary sources by using primary sources, such as original documents or data, to provide firsthand evidence and support arguments. Secondary sources, like scholarly articles or books, can be used to provide context, analysis, and additional perspectives on the topic. By combining both types of sources, the paper can offer a more comprehensive and credible examination of the subject matter.
